What is the difference between Packaging Engineer Manager vs Packaging Engineer?

AspectPackaging Engineer ManagerPackaging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in Packaging, Engineering, or related field; often with leadership experienceBachelor's degree in Packaging, Engineering, or related field
Work EnvironmentLeadership roles overseeing teams, project management, strategic planningDesign, testing, and development of packaging solutions
Employer & Industry UsageManufacturing, consumer goods, logistics companiesPackaging design firms, manufacturing plants, consumer product companies

The Packaging Engineer Manager focuses on leading teams, managing projects, and strategic planning, while the Packaging Engineer is primarily involved in designing and developing packaging solutions. Both roles require similar technical credentials, but the manager role includes leadership responsibilities and oversight.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Packaging Engineer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Packaging Engineer Manager, you need expertise in packaging design, materials science, and engineering principles, typically supported by a degree in packaging engineering or a related field and relevant management experience. Familiarity with CAD software, packaging testing equipment, and regulatory compliance standards is essential. Strong leadership, project management, and cross-functional communication skills help drive team performance and innovation. These skills ensure efficient, cost-effective, and sustainable packaging solutions that meet business objectives and regulatory requirements.

How does a Packaging Engineer Manager typically collaborate with other departments to ensure successful product launches?

A Packaging Engineer Manager works closely with cross-functional teams such as product development, marketing, procurement, and manufacturing to ensure packaging solutions meet both technical requirements and brand standards. This collaboration often involves coordinating timelines, aligning on material specifications, and ensuring compliance with regulatory and sustainability standards. Effective communication and project management skills are essential, as the manager must balance different priorities and resolve challenges that arise during the development and launch phases.

What does a Packaging Engineer Manager do?

A Packaging Engineer Manager oversees the design, development, and implementation of packaging solutions for products. They manage a team of packaging engineers, coordinate projects, ensure compliance with safety and regulatory standards, and work with suppliers and internal stakeholders to optimize packaging for cost, sustainability, and functionality. Their role often involves leading innovation in packaging materials and processes to improve efficiency and reduce environmental impact.

How much do packaging engineers make in the US?

Packaging engineers in the US typically earn a median annual salary of around $70,000 to $90,000, with experienced professionals and those in managerial roles earning higher. Salaries can vary based on location, industry, education, and certifications such as PMP or Six Sigma. Entry-level positions generally start lower, while senior roles may exceed $100,000 annually.

Are packaging engineers in demand?

Packaging engineers are in demand due to the growth of e-commerce, consumer goods, and sustainable packaging initiatives. They are often required to have skills in materials, design, and manufacturing processes, with opportunities available across various industries worldwide.

Job description

We are a large growing packaging company working in the cosmetic industry. This is a full-time position with great benefits, retirement package, and plenty of room for career growth. Responsibilities: Review and identify packaging issues, and provide value solutions.

Working closely with the Director of Customer Service, as well as art, marketing, sales, engineering, purchasing, customer service, maintenance, cost, production, and packaging team members to determine costs and possibilities of producing the proposed packaging. Develop, review, improve, and ensure production packaging designs (secondary and tertiary packaging components) are following all: display, regulations, and shipping conditions to ensure production satisfaction in early phase of upcoming packaging for approval. Which may include: sketches, specs, written analysis, samples, etc.

Maintains specs database for all packaging and pallet patterns. As wells as re-engineer, design, analyzing engineering specs and drawing of products to determine physical description of the item, safety requirements, handling, and the type of materials required for packaging to ensure process and quality improvement. Ability to lift and pull a minimum of 25 lbs.

Among: standing, sitting, and walking for long periods of time. Other duties as assigned. Requirements: Local Ability to travel.

Stable work-history. Bachelor's Degree in Packaging Engineering or Mechanical Engineering preferred. 2+ years of field related experience as a Packaging Engineer in Cosmetic Manufacturing in packaging development, consumer packaging, rapid prototyping, project management or similar related field experience is preferred.

Strong knowledge in mathematical, mechanical, and engineering. Software knowledge in CAD, Adobe Illustrator, CAPE/Topps, MS Office, and other web based analytical application and manufacturing database software knowledge is a plus. Knowledge packaging validation standards, drafting, specification standards, among others: specifications, guidelines and regulations are required.
